Report Summary
BMI estimates that, by the end of June 2008, the number of mobile customers in Vietnam had risen to over 51.6mn. Our estimates are based on the latest data to be published by Vietnam’s Ministry of Information and Communications (MIC), which suggested that there were almost 50mn mobile subscribers in Vietnam at the beginning of June. According to MIC figures, Viettel, which is owned by the Vietnamese military, continued to lead the Vietnamese mobile market with a market share of around 38%. Viettel has a clear lead over the next largest mobile operators, MobiFone and VinaPhone, which had market shares of approximately 26% and 24%, respectively.
We have made some further alterations to our forecast for mobile subscriber growth in Vietnam, in order to take account of much stronger growth in the first few months of 2008. We now envisage a growth rate of almost 80% for 2008. By the end of the year, we predict that the subscriber base will have risen to over 64mn, and that the mobile penetration rate will have reached 73%. It should be remembered that the figures for the number of Vietnamese mobile customers are based on the assumption that the market contains a large number of inactive prepaid users.
Competition and growth in Vietnam’s mobile sector has been boosted by the recent wave of tariff cuts, which have been introduced by the various operators. Further cuts may follow in the near future, possibly resulting in a price war. Looking ahead, we now predict that Vietnam will surpass the 100% penetration threshold in 2010, instead of 2011 as previously predicted. By the end of 2012, we envisage almost 136mn customers and a penetration rate of almost 147%. Continued customer growth will be supported by a steadily expanding population, as well as the arrival of increased competition and new investment.
Meanwhile, according to Vietnam’s Internet Network Information Centre (VNNIC), the number of broadband subscribers rose by 37% in the first eight months of 2008. By the end of August, broadband penetration in Vietnam had risen to 2%, up from 1.5% at the end of 2007. Recent months have seen accelerated efforts to increase the level of investment in broadband technologies and to encourage further take-up. In September 2008, incumbent operator VNPT launched a campaign to promote its ‘MegaVNN’ ADSL service to fixed-line users. The promotion, which runs from September 16 to October 30, offered free ADSL modem and registration fees for new MegaVNN users and customers who shifted their indirect internet services to MegaVNN on fixed phone lines. BMI continues to believe that broadband subscriber growth will be strong over the next five years. However, we now predict a lower rate of expansion for 2008, envisaging growth of no more than 100% for the year as a whole. By the end of 2008, we forecast a market of almost 2.57mn broadband subscribers (equivalent to a penetration rate of 2.9%).
